Output 2100d4a1ea86d37d1f2e7962d7447ebaa23869cf28e080b5e750a5ec83ebf45f:44

value
690520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f013593e8874e530e285068cd721a1fcc30b444a OP_EQUAL
address
3PaRGwwaYRK65oHhw2u3F3u2YMFMhQs9td
transaction
2100d4a1ea86d37d1f2e7962d7447ebaa23869cf28e080b5e750a5ec83ebf45f
spent
true